Transaction bf66f2fc16357a5b3bf45bb1167721ea445f5ec610f4774ccb90cd96b9561c3e
1 Input
1 Output
-
bf66f2fc16357a5b3bf45bb1167721ea445f5ec610f4774ccb90cd96b9561c3e:0
- value
- 527355
- script pubkey
- OP_0 OP_PUSHBYTES_20 370ed51a5d78fbe656e14c8a1d41b89be770775d
- address
- bc1qxu8d2xja0ra7v4hpfj9p6sdcn0nhqa6alm6nte